Probiotics, Prebiotics, and Immunostimulants are natural health-supporting ingredients used in aquaculture to keep fish and shrimp healthy and productive. Probiotics are beneficial microorganisms added to feed or water that help maintain a balanced gut, improve digestion, and protect aquatic animals from harmful bacteria. Prebiotics are special nutrients that feed these beneficial microbes, helping them grow and work more effectively in the digestive system. Immunostimulants strengthen the natural immune response of aquatic animals, making them more resistant to stress, infections, and disease outbreaks. Together, these solutions support better growth, higher survival rates, and healthier farming systems while reducing dependence on antibiotics, making aquaculture more sustainable and efficient.

1. Rising Demand for Antibiotic-Free Aquaculture: Growing concerns over antibiotic resistance and residue in seafood are encouraging farmers to adopt probiotics, prebiotics, and immunostimulants as safer alternatives.
2. Increasing Disease Challenges in Aquaculture: Frequent disease outbreaks in fish and shrimp farming are driving the need for preventive health solutions that strengthen immunity and reduce mortality rates.
3. Growing Focus on Sustainable Aquaculture Practices: Aquaculture producers are increasingly adopting eco-friendly and sustainable farming methods, boosting demand for natural health-enhancing feed additives.
4. Improved Growth Performance and Feed Efficiency: These additives help enhance digestion, nutrient absorption, and overall growth, making them attractive to farmers seeking better productivity and profitability.
5. Rising Global Seafood Consumption: Increasing demand for fish and shrimp is pushing aquaculture operations to improve animal health and survival, fueling market growth.
6. Supportive Regulatory Environment: Stricter regulations on antibiotic use in aquaculture are accelerating the adoption of probiotics, prebiotics, and immunostimulants across global markets
